The Root of the Roar: Understanding Why We Snore

To understand how an anti-snoring mouthpiece works, we first need to grasp why we snore. Snoring occurs when the airflow through the nose and mouth is partially obstructed during sleep. As we relax in slumber, the muscles in our throat, jaw, and tongue also relax. This relaxation can cause the soft tissues at the back of the throat – the soft palate, uvula, and tongue – to sag and partially block the airway.

When air is then forced through this narrowed passage, these relaxed tissues vibrate, much like a flag flapping in the wind. This vibration is the sound we know as snoring. Factors that can exacerbate this include alcohol consumption, certain medications, sleeping on your back, obesity, and even nasal congestion.

It’s important to differentiate between primary snoring and Obstructive Sleep Apnea (OSA). While primary snoring is a nuisance, OSA is a serious medical condition where breathing repeatedly stops and starts during sleep. Sufferers of OSA often snore loudly, but their breathing pauses can last for ten seconds or more, leading to a sudden gasp or choke as they restart breathing. This can happen hundreds of times a night, severely disrupting sleep and carrying significant health risks, including high blood pressure, heart disease, stroke, and diabetes. This is why a professional diagnosis is critically important; a stop snoring device should always be used under medical guidance, especially if OSA is suspected.

The Method – A Deep Dive into Mandibular Advancement Devices

A mandibular advancement device (MAD) is the most common and effective type of over-the-counter or custom-fitted dental approach to tackle snoring. Its design is ingenious in its simplicity and profound in its impact.

The Core Mechanism: How a MAD Works

The fundamental principle behind a MAD is to gently hold the lower jaw (mandible) slightly forward and down during sleep. This seemingly small adjustment creates a cascade of beneficial effects:

  • Tenses Throat Muscles: By moving the jaw forward, it also pulls the soft tissues at the back of the throat – including the tongue and soft palate – away from the airway. This tension prevents them from collapsing and vibrating.
  • Widens the Airway: The forward position of the jaw effectively creates more space in the pharynx, the part of the throat behind the mouth and nasal cavity. A wider, unobstructed airway means air can flow freely without causing vibrations.
  • Prevents Tongue Collapse: The tongue, a major culprit in snoring, is also held forward, preventing it from falling back and blocking the airway, especially when sleeping on one’s back.

This action directly prevents the narrowing of the airway that leads to the snoring sound, offering a silent and restorative night’s sleep.

Choosing Your Type: Boil-and-Bite vs. Custom-Fit

When considering a stop snoring device like a MAD, you’ll generally encounter two main types:

  • Boil-and-Bite (Thermoplastic): These are the most accessible and affordable options. As the name suggests, they are made from a thermoplastic material that softens in hot water. Users then bite into the softened material, creating an impression of their teeth. Once cooled, the device retains this shape, providing a personalized, albeit basic, fit.
    • Pros: Affordable, readily available online or in pharmacies, allows for at-home fitting.
    • Cons: Fit can be less precise, potentially leading to discomfort, jaw soreness, or even falling out during the night. Durability may be lower, and they might not be as effective for all users. They serve as a good entry point to see if the MAD principle works for you before investing in a more premium solution.
  • Professionally Fitted (Custom-Made): These devices are prescribed and fabricated by a dentist specializing in sleep medicine. The process involves taking precise molds or digital scans of your teeth and jaw. The device is then custom-made in a lab to perfectly fit your unique oral anatomy.
    • Pros: Superior comfort, precise fit, optimal efficacy, and enhanced durability. Dentists can adjust the advancement incrementally for maximum comfort and effectiveness. Often provides better long-term results and minimizes side effects.
    • Cons: Higher cost and requires multiple dental visits for fitting and adjustments. For those truly committed to finding a lasting snoring solution, the investment often pays off in terms of comfort, effectiveness, and peace of mind.

Key Features for Comfort and Efficacy

Regardless of the type, certain features contribute significantly to the effectiveness and comfort of a good anti-snoring mouthpiece:

  • Adjustable Advancement: This is perhaps the most crucial feature. Many MADs allow for gradual, millimeter-by-millimeter adjustment of the lower jaw’s forward position. This allows users to find the optimal balance between opening the airway and maintaining comfort, minimizing jaw strain. Initial adjustments are typically small and increased over time.
  • Hypoallergenic Materials: Look for medical-grade, BPA-free, and latex-free materials to prevent allergic reactions or irritation.
  • Airflow Channels/Breathing Holes: For individuals who tend to breathe through their mouths during sleep, devices with small openings or channels allow for unimpeded oral breathing, enhancing comfort and preventing a feeling of claustrophobia.
  • Slim Profile: A less bulky device will generally be more comfortable to wear, especially for extended periods.
  • Retention: The device should fit securely enough to stay in place all night without causing discomfort or irritation to gums and teeth.

Addressing Concerns & Maximizing Success

Adopting any new sleep aid comes with questions. Here’s a look at common concerns regarding anti-snoring mouthpieces:

Comfort & Side Effects

It’s common to experience some temporary side effects when first using an anti-snoring mouthpiece, particularly with boil-and-bite options. These can include:

  • Jaw Soreness: Your jaw muscles are being held in a new position, so some stiffness or soreness is normal, especially in the first few days or weeks. This often subsides as your jaw adjusts. Using devices with adjustable settings allows for gradual advancement, significantly mitigating this issue.
  • Tooth Discomfort/Tenderness: Pressure on your teeth from the device can cause temporary tenderness.
  • Excess Salivation: Your mouth may produce more saliva initially as it senses a foreign object. This usually diminishes over time.
  • Dry Mouth: Conversely, some might experience a dry mouth if the device alters natural airflow.

Most of these side effects are mild and transient. If they persist or are severe, consult your dentist or doctor, as the fit might need adjustment or the device might not be suitable for you.

Safety & Suitability

While highly effective, an anti-snoring mouthpiece isn’t suitable for everyone. It’s crucial to consult a healthcare professional before use, especially if you have:

  • TMJ Disorders (Temporomandibular Joint Disorder): Moving the jaw forward can exacerbate TMJ symptoms.
  • Gum Disease or Loose Teeth: The device could put undue pressure on compromised dental structures.
  • Significant Dental Work: Extensive bridges, crowns, or dentures might interfere with the fit and effectiveness.
  • Insufficient Teeth: A certain number of healthy teeth are needed to anchor the device securely.
  • Central Sleep Apnea: MADs are designed for Obstructive Sleep Apnea, not Central Sleep Apnea, which involves a different physiological mechanism.

Care and Maintenance

Proper care ensures the longevity and hygiene of your device:

  • Clean Daily: After each use, brush your mouthpiece with a toothbrush and cool water (never hot, as it can deform thermoplastic devices). Use a mild soap or denture cleaner as recommended by the manufacturer.
  • Rinse Thoroughly: Ensure all cleaning agents are rinsed off before storing.
  • Store Dry: Allow the device to air dry before placing it in its protective case to prevent bacterial growth.
  • Regular Inspections: Periodically check for cracks, wear, or damage, which could compromise effectiveness or comfort.

Frequently Asked Questions (FAQs)

1. What is the difference between a Mandibular Advancement Device (MAD) and a Tongue Stabilizing Device (TSD)?

A Mandibular Advancement Device (MAD) works by gently pushing the lower jaw forward to open the airway. A Tongue Stabilizing Device (TSD), on the other hand, holds the tongue in a forward position using suction, preventing it from falling back and obstructing the airway. Both are types of anti-snoring mouthpieces, but they address different anatomical mechanisms of snoring. Your healthcare provider can help determine which is more suitable for your specific snoring pattern.

2. How long does it take to get used to wearing an anti-snoring mouthpiece?

Most users experience an adjustment period of a few days to a couple of weeks. During this time, you might notice temporary jaw soreness, tooth tenderness, or increased salivation. It’s important to be patient and consistent. If discomfort persists or is severe, consult your dentist, as the fit or adjustment of your mandibular advancement device might need modification.
